Skapa en DualShock 4 kontrollerade Arduino (1 / 8 steg)
Steg 1: Samla hårdvara
Här är all hårdvara måste du styra din Arduino med en DualShock 4 controller:
1. Arduino Uno - mikrokontroller styrelse som tillåter en användare att köra sina egna anpassade firmware.
2. USB 2.0 Host Shield - detta är ett måste. Hittade här, USB Host Shield passar rätt på toppen av Ardiono Uno och ger stöd för många USB-enheter.
3. USB Bluetooth dongle - där är en lista över Bluetooth-donglar som är kompatibla med USB Host Shield, många av dem mycket liten och billig. Jag fick min på Amazon här.
4. DualShock 4 controller - den här domänkontrollanten fungerar via en Bluetooth-anslutning med en PlayStation 4 spelkonsol från Sony. Med USB Host Shield bibliotek har vi full tillgång till handkontrollens många knappar, joysticks, utlösare, gyroskop, accelerometrar och LED. Registeransvarige avgifter med en micro USB-kabel, så det är också möjligt att använda handkontrollen på ett fast sätt med styrelsen, men vi är intresserade av den trådlösa kapaciteten.
5. datorn med USB-port - The Arduino kräver en annan dator att skriva program för det och en seriell anslutning till skriva till Arduino styrelsen. Ansluta Arduino till en dator via USB B-porten på chip. Denna USB-anslutning ger både makt och seriell kommunikation till styrelsen. För programvara-relaterade åtgärder, kommer jag antar att du använder en Windows-dator, för enkelhet. Följande är möjliga med mycket lite extra arbete i både Mac och Linux. Om du stöter på någon kompatibilitet frågor Använd Google för att hitta en OS-specifika lösning, lovar jag de alla finns.